The Clouded Yellow is primarily an immigrant to the UK, originating from north Africa and southern Europe, with numbers varying greatly from year to year - an estimated 36,000 butterflies appearing in one of the infrequent "Clouded Yellow" years in 1947. WebbHow to identify. The speckled wood is dark brown with creamy yellow spots. The best way to identify the 'brown' butterflies is by looking at the eyespots on their wings. Knowing where the … how is jelly beans madeWebbSpeckled Wood Butterfly. Pararge aegeria. Brown wings with pale yellow spots, 1 black and white eyespot on the forewing and 3 on the hind. Undersides are patterned orange, yellow, and brown. Often found perched in sunny spots, before spiralling into the air to chase each other.
